Company Overview:
Founded in 2020 by a 25-year veteran in the procurement vertical, Focal Point looks at end-to-end procurement through a practitioner lens. Excel and email are still the most prevalent tools used by procurement professionals resulting in work being done off system, ad-hoc and inconsistently.

Since the initial product was launched in 2021 with two global name-brand clients Focal Point has enjoyed an average of >300% annual growth (year over year) due to attracting more than five F500 (two of which are F50) companies.
Our Client Delivery team is growing due to the rapid customer growth we are experiencing and forecasting for 2024 and beyond. The Client Delivery team is responsible for the onboarding experience of new clients, ongoing client support as well as testing new product features.

Project Manager
Focal Point is looking for a Project Manager to join the Client Delivery team. The Project Manager will play a vital role in maintaining our position as an innovative organization. The ideal candidate will have system implementation experience and strong skills in developing and overseeing work plans. The Project Manager will also prepare and present updates regularly to management, ensuring that our customer goals are being achieved. The individual in this position is expected to work independently and with project teams following best practices to complete customer installations or updates on time. This position will be required to support internal and external project management teams, leading and guiding customers to final deployments for their resolutions.

The objectives of the role include:
• Building and developing the project team to ensure maximum performance, by providing purpose, direction, and motivation.
• Lead projects from requirements definition through deployment, identifying schedules, scopes, budget estimations, and implementation plans, including risk mitigation.
• Coordinate internal and external resources to ensure that projects adhere to scope, schedule, and budget.
• Analyze project status and, when necessary, revise the scope, schedule, or budget to ensure that project requirements can be met.
• Establish and maintain relationships with relevant client stakeholders, providing day-to-day contact on project status and changes.
